[1] Puzzles

I woke up in a white room⁠—completely empty except for a single locked door and a golden scepter on the floor in front of me.

0


I approached the scepter and stared at it for what felt like an hour before finally deciding to pick it up. I examined it just as it began to shake, and it shot a golden flame at the door. When the flame hit, a loud buzzing noise sounded overhead and the locked door was gone.

0


I carefully approached the area where the door once was and looked through it. Ahead of me was a room similar to the one I was currently in, but the walls were painted to look like trees. Several real looking small huts and fake plastic snakes were spread around the room. I had nowhere else to go but forward. A loud rumbling sound came from behind me, and I turned to find that the doorway I had entered through was gone. Finally, I noticed that this room had two locked doors.

0


Hoping it would be as easy this time as it was the last, I began my search of the area. I noticed a few of the painted trees had letters carved into them. The tall birch in the corner displayed the initials “M.S.”, along with an X. A rowan tree that was where the old door used to be bore “R.S.” and a checkmark.

0


I continued to search the room, exploring each of the huts. They were simple in structure, each holding a single small room. The smallest hut, which I could barely fit into, contained a single, unlabeled book. I managed to pull it out and discovered it was about snakes. It described the different species and how to identify them. I compared the identifications to the plastic snakes scattered across the ground and quickly figured out each snake was modeled after an actual species. That’s when I realized — milk snake (or “M.S.”) and rattlesnake (or “R.S.”). Using the book, I located both snakes and brought them to the doors.

0


The modeled snakes, after I set the both of them in front of their respective doors, began to suddenly writhe and shake on the floor. I stifled a gasp as they slid up the sides of the doors, but the milk snake stopped abruptly.

0


The rattlesnake slid around the doorknob of its door, and its hinges creaked as it swung open to reveal a room with an exterior painted like a desert as far as I could see.

0


The milk snake, however, was frozen on the side of the other door.

0


I gasped. What had I done wrong? I hoped this snake wasn’t dead. I flipped back to the milk snake page in the book, but for some reason, it was gone. I went through the book again and again for what felt like hours until I came to the conclusion that the page really wasn’t there. Had I gone insane?

0


I closed the book. Either way, what was done was done. I had to move on.

0


I tried to walk through the open rattlesnake door, but I couldn't. Some invisible force was keeping me out.

0


I dropped the book, and this time I wasn't stopped. The door closed and locked behind me.
